    Default Prop Story...

    I was racing for Harry Bartolomei, in 1967, and we went to Valleyfield to race the John Ward Race (500 CC World Championships)...Harry was, maybe I should say still is, a man who never worried about what things cost. Pop Smith, without a doubt, was the greatest propeller man EVER. He had worked in a forge before he started working propellers. His propellers were as close to perfect pitches as could be made. Pop Smith even taught Mercury Marine Propeller people how to work propellers. I have been in the propeller business since 1969, and consider myself an expert, but I would never want to be compared to Pop Smith (R.Allen Smith was his real name)as I know I could not compete with POP!!!!...Pop and I were great friends, we had several business agreements that made both of us money....I made him castings, he made me props.
    But in 1967, few people in the world, Waldman and Hering maybe, Harry Bartolomei had a complete selection of Smith Alky wheels...(MAYBE 25 props)...

    We got to Valleyfield and ran the 500 CC qualifier..I ran a Dieter Schultz hydro and a VC Konig (New ROTARY VALVE) 500 CC engine...I qualified with a fifth in my heat, two heats, which meant I was a 10th for the final, maybe 9th...

    At the Saturday evening pre race party, Dieter Konig asked Harry why he didn't run the muffler. (We had run open stacks)...Harry answered he liked to hear them wind...Dieter said, "Run the MUFFLA".....Dieter Schultz asked why we ran didn't run the "Mufflaa?" We said, It ran best without the muffler."...Dieter Konig and Dieter Schultz said, "Run the muffleaa and Smith wheel number 295 V..." THEY FIGURED HARRY DIDN'T HAVE A 295 V BLOCK. PROP...(As they had some favors in their pockets at this race)..

    Harry told me, he had a 295 V in the trailer. We put the 295 V and the muffler on and Harry added a LITTLE NITRO... Bottom Line, we won the 500 CC World Championships, and I invented LAY DOWN HYDRO....as that Konig with 20% NITRO, SMITH WHEEL 295 V, HAD SO MUCH POWER I COULD NOT KNEEL, I HAD TO LAY DOWN TO DRIVE.

    I went from RAGS to RICHES with a propeller change...muffler change and a lot of nitro....

    Thanks, Harry Bartolomei for giving me the chance to drive your 500 CC at the John Waard Trophy Race.!!!

    Harry is the one that taught me I didn't race for money. The first heat out at Valleyfield was A Outboard Hydro..I won and $100 Canadian Dollars... Waldman and Herring were behind me. The reason I had won the heat was it was rough as hell and my throttlwe stick wide open. I remembered Gerry Hedlund telling me how he'd won an "A" Hydro rce when his throttle stuck but choking the motor going into the turn. So, that is what I did. And it worked.

    Next heat was the John Ward Race..I won the first heat. As I started to get in my A Outboard Hydro throttle fixed for the second heat, Harry said, "Ron, rest, don't go out." I said, "Harry, they are paying $100 a heat to win...." Harry reached into his pocket, pulled out two one hundred dollar bills and handed them to me...And said, "Sit down and rest."

    I said, "Harry I want to kick those guy's ***..."..It was then I realized I didn't race for money... I raced to win!!!!
